Output 9a0437304daeb6750a17c3d7cfa4f8e03fbb18e5041fdeeb31296253a24deded:1

value
15887125
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dddd12da08b785e611cb970acef83fccda78c1da OP_EQUAL
address
3Mv86QPR4vwcmG7DjPBEUkkyJJmFphbttS
transaction
9a0437304daeb6750a17c3d7cfa4f8e03fbb18e5041fdeeb31296253a24deded
confirmations
360450
spent
true